They are trained to diagnose the specific type of hair loss you're experiencing, whether it's genetic pattern hair loss, alopecia areata, telogen effluvium from stress, or a condition related to the scalp itself.
Consulting with a specialist is crucial because effective treatment depends entirely on an accurate diagnosis. What works for one type of hair loss may not work for another. During a visit, a dermatologist will thoroughly examine your scalp and hair, discuss your health history, and may order blood tests to check for underlying issues like thyroid problems or nutritional deficiencies common in our area. They then create a targeted plan, which may include FDA-approved topical treatments like minoxidil, prescription medications, in-office procedures such as corticosteroid injections or laser therapy, and expert guidance on proper hair care.
